EU/US : MALTA ENTERS VISA WAIVER PROGRAMME.

PositionBrief article

Maltese nationals, from 30 December 2008, can travel to the United States for up to 90 days for tourism or business without a visa, the US administration has announced. This means that among the EU27, only Bulgaria, Cyprus, Greece, Poland and Romania are not on the Visa Waiver Programme (VWP). The EU wants the remainder added in 2009 but this is not sure as certain powerful US senators feel the programme leaves America vulnerable to terrorist attacks.

Though the move is undoubtedly good news for the Maltese, this issue has not been as sensitive with domestic opinion there as it has been in the Central and East European countries. That is because a higher proportion of the latter's nationals visit the US and the governments of these countries view membership of the VWP as confirming their status as close allies of the US.
